Obama has been running rampant for the past month prior. Now we have word that he’s deployed (as of Thursday, January 12) U.S. troops and armored units to Poland. The following statement by the Russians was reported by ABC News that outlines the gravity of such a maneuver and the threat to Russia as the Russians see it:

“These actions threaten our interests, our security,” President Vladimir Putin’s spokesman Dmitry Peskov said Thursday. “Especially as it concerns a third party building up its military presence near our borders. It’s not even a European state.”

Recently the State Department has been sending more weapons to “rebels” fighting the Assad government in Syria. There are also further deployments of U.S. troops planned: one of which is to Lithuania at the end of this month. These are all coming on the heels of deployments to Latvia, Estonia, and Moldova, the latter of which now has American missile defense systems that can also be fitted with Tomahawk missiles and placed into offensive capabilities within a matter of hours.
